Wincc7.0 sp3 对象移动

图形对象从X1移位到X2水平移动,再从从X2移位到X1水平移动。自动重复移动,该怎样做?

最佳答案

定义一个内部变量position 32位整数,一个移动方向flag bool,全局脚本vbs中:
dim tag(2)
tag(0)=hmiruntime.tags("flag").read
tag(1)=hmiruntime.tags("position").read
if tag(0) then
tag(1)=tag(1)+10
else tag(1)=tag1-10
end if
if tag(1)>=5000 then‘向右超过x2位置,开始左移
hmiruntime.tags("flag").write 0
end if
if tag(1)<=100 then’向左超过x1位置,开始右移
hmiruntime.tags("flag").write 1
end if

提问者对于答案的评价:
谢谢

专家置评

已阅,最佳答案正确。

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c196647.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2017年8月24日 上午3:20
下一篇 2017年8月24日 上午3:20

相关推荐

  • wincc6.0 sp3 项目激活后,不能登录

    wincc6.0sp3,项目激活后,不能登录,点击登录按钮,没反应。但把项目拷贝到其他电脑,正常. 最佳答案 1.与计算机名字无关,如果计算机名字不一致,哪激活都是不可能的;&nb…

    SIMATIC WinCC 2019年6月11日
  • Automation License Manager打不开

    Automation License Manager打不开 提示:没有启动“自动化许可证管理器服务”    &…

    SIMATIC WinCC 2019年6月11日
  • WINCC 按钮对象属性的事件里C动作触发问题

    我做了一个按钮,在事件里组态了鼠标左击C动作,总感觉我鼠标按下去后动作并不立即执行,有延时,对于事件的C动作我怎么控制它的触发周期呢?  我记得别的都有UPON…

    2017年12月10日
  • WinCCshouquan

    请问:WinCCV7.0授权长期秘钥到底如何选择?试了很多次不同授权组合,但一直都有提示A9WRC?0700缺失许可证,下图是现在所安装的授权组合,仍然不行。望高手指点迷津,谢谢 …

    2021年7月5日
  • I/O与输入输出问题

    急急急!在做一个I/O与输入输出时,当作为输入时,为什么输入的十六进制变量总是以十进制的形式显示。变量定义的是内部无符号16数。输入属性设置是以十六进制数据格式显示。谢谢,请指教啊…

    SIMATIC WinCC 2019年6月11日
  • 关于wincc中properties的问题

    在wincc中,右击Graphic Designer 中的对象,选择properties属性,怎么properties属性对话框打不开啊?急啊 最佳答案 应该是…

    SIMATIC WinCC 2019年6月11日
  • WINCC V7 制作公共画面

    小弟项目施工有很多个阀门和电机,需要制作给阀门和电机制作公共画面。连接的是1200  1500系列   使用结构化变量连接绝对地址…

    SIMATIC WinCC 2020年11月1日
  • wincc7.3有没有虚拟变量可以使用?

    设备通过变送后,采集的数值不能直接通过点得出。在Wincc7.3中有没有虚拟变量,可以将几个值运算后变成一个虚拟值,直接读取? 最佳答案 虚拟变量是什么?按描述感觉可以使用内部变量…

    SIMATIC WinCC 2021年7月5日
  • wincc 7.0 SQL 安装失败 报警CODE 69

    wincc  7.0   SQL 2005时 安装失败 报警 CODE 69我的…

    SIMATIC WinCC 2019年6月11日
  • 200smart和wincc通讯问题?

    200SMART的V区对应DB1, AIW对应什么plc用的200smart,用网上的的方法,想建立smart和上位机wincc的链接,opc server那一…

    2020年11月1日